Obama on track with Cabinet picks, poll says
Posted: 04:10 PM ET
By Paul Steinhauser
CNN Deputy Political Director

WASHINGTON (CNN) — A new national poll suggests that Americans think President-elect Barack Obama’s getting it right when it comes to his Cabinet picks, especially Hillary Clinton and Robert Gates.

Seventy-five percent of those questioned in a CNN/Opinion Research Corporation survey approve of Obama’s Cabinet choices, with 22 percent disapproving. That’s 16 points higher than those in favor of then President-elect George W. Bush’s Cabinet picks eight years ago.

The poll indicates that 71 percent approve of Obama’s nomination of Clinton, D-New York, as his secretary of state. Democrats overwhelming approve of the choice, with two-thirds of Independents agreeing and Republicans split on the pick
